NORSOK M501 Certification Imminent for Kuangshun Photosensitivity Domestic Heavy-Duty Anticorrosive Coatings Break into Marine Engineering Market

HZ info2025-07-04 14:02

HZ info: China’s marine engineering coatings sector is poised for a critical breakthrough. Jiangsu Kuangshun Photosensitivity New-Material Stock Co., Ltd. (hereinafter "Kuangshun Photosensitivity") announced that its eco-friendly graphene-modified heavy-duty anticorrosive coating has entered the final stage of NORSOK M-501 international certification. The certification is expected to be completed by late June to early July. Upon approval, the product will enter the supply chain of China National Offshore Oil Corporation (CNOOC), marking a historic "zero-to-one" breakthrough for domestic marine coatings.

The NORSOK M-501 standard, established by Norway’s petroleum industry for extreme North Sea conditions, sets higher technical thresholds than general ISO/ASTM standards. It mandates rigorous performance and testing protocols under harsh environments including high salinity, subzero temperatures, intense waves, UV radiation, persistent humidity, cyclic wet-dry transitions, and complex cathodic protection systems. Certification guarantees a protective lifespan exceeding 15–25 years for materials in extreme marine settings.

In the current heavy-duty anticorrosive coatings market, marine and ship coatings predominantly rely on zinc-based "sacrificial methods" for passive corrosion resistance. Kuangshun Photosensitivity employs an innovative "shielding method" using two-dimensional nanolayer structures for active protection. The graphene-modified lamellar architecture delivers high-performance, long-term defense while offering operational efficiencies: reduced surface preparation, high coating efficiency, and shortened recoating intervals. Its solvent-free, high-solid formulation further minimizes VOCs emissions, providing sustainable maintenance solutions that redefine industry standards and advance domestic substitution in the high-barrier marine coatings sector.

This technological breakthrough coincides with a strategic industrial transition period. China’s marine coatings market now exceeds RMB 40 billion, where giants like AkzoNobel and PPG dominate. Evolving demand drivers include aging offshore platforms requiring replacement. CNOOC alone operates over 50 offshore drilling platforms built in the 1970s–1980s, exceeding their 30-year design life. These structures undergo refurbishment at a rate of 10 platforms annually, creating vast opportunities for technological disruptors.

Despite positioning marine coatings as a strategic growth segment, Kuangshun Photosensitivity faced a revenue-growth-profit-mismatch in 2024. Annual reports show revenue reached RMB 518 million (up 1.63% YoY), with gross margin hitting a five-year high of 38.02%. However, a goodwill impairment of RMB 29.91 million from subsidiary Jiangsu Hongtai and electronic business challenges resulted in a net loss of RMB 32.06 million. Despite profit and operational cash flow pressures, the company’s competitive resilience remains underpinned by advancements in PCB photoresist localization, photovoltaic adhesive technology, and graphene anticorrosive innovations.

In the commercialization phase for heavy-duty anticorrosive coatings, Kuangshun Photosensitivity has established market pathways. Following batch orders for specialty valves and port facilities, the company now focuses on marine engineering equipment and energy/mining sectors in highly corrosive environments. Volume deployment with strategic large enterprises is projected to commence in Q3 2025.
